2004 rim struggles

Years ago when I bought my current rims, I had no idea that 04 - 05+ had different rims.
I currently have 20" king ranch rims on it, with 35x12.5 mud tires. They rub when I crank it lock to lock.

fast forward to today. I need new tires and I don't want to put the new tires through the same torture.
I hate the majority of aftermarket wheels. I dont like fancy, I dont like any crazy wheel poke. I prefer my tires to be inside the fender lip. I don't mind the cali invader wheels but they are -25 offset. I've been thinking about some thin wheel spacers, but I only tow with the truck . Any issues there?
I'm looking for something similar to what's on the truck or the cali's . Any recommendations? Anyone have a measurement or pic of -25 offset wheels on an 04?

Most stock wheels are a + offset so the tires sit behind the fenders. A zero offset means that bolting face of the rim is exactly in the middle of the rim. A negative offset moves that bolting surface closer to the vehicle pushing the rim away from the vehicle.

These are Moto Metals without the center caps with a 0 offset and Cooper 275/65R20 tires. They are the largest diameter tire I can fit without rubbing lock to lock. If I remember correctly they are 34.4” diameter. They stick out about 3/4” beyond the fenders.

Are you currently running spacers with those OEM 20”s? If not, I would think that you are rubbing the tires on the front leaf springs well before getting to steering lock.
Your original wheels along with those 20”s are hubcentric so using thin spacers like you mentioned may push the wheels out off of the hub leaving them uncentered.
Up until the end of ‘04 the only 16”+ OEM SD wheels were the 4 similar, but unique versions of the 5 spoke ‘04 Lariat, King Ranch, Harley Davidson and SVT 18”X8”. These 18” wheels have the correct geometry to properly fit the pre ‘05 trucks without the need for spacers keeping the tires inside the fenders where they belong. I run the ‘04 Lariat 18X8 wheels on my Excursion with 305/70R18 Nitto Dura Grapplers (35.25”X12.8”). The tires are completely under the truck and only slightly rub the front springs at full lock due to the bigger tires. This series of wheel are kind of rare but are still out there and are a good solid OEM choice for the pre ‘05 trucks.
